Shegetz (?????? or in Hebrew ?????????; alternative Romanizations incl. shaygetz, sheigetz, shaigetz, sheygets; plural ?????? shkotzim, shgatzim) is a Yiddish word that has entered English to refer to a non-Jewish boy or young man.
